Ilang metro ang 1300 sentimetro?<br><br>a. 1metro<br>b. 13 metro<br>c. 130 metro​
Pie

Answer:

1300 cm = 13 m

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to find meters in 1300 cm.

We know that,

1 m = 100 cm

1 cm = (1/100) m

It means,

1300\ cm=\dfrac{1300}{100}\ m\\\\=13\ m

Hence, there are 13 m in 1300 cm.

The bearing of a plane from the airport is 65.
Ulleksa [173]

Answer:

The bearing of the airport from the plane is 245°

Step-by-step explanation:

The bearing of a point from a location is given by the angle in degrees of rotation from the Northern direction of the location to the direction of the location of the point

The given bearing of the plane from the airport = 65°

Therefore, the direction of the plane from the Northern direction of the airport = 65°

From the Northern direction of the plane, the bearing of the airport = 245°
